Navigating the handset menu
Your BT Equinox 1350 has a handset menu system
which is easy to use. Each menu leads to a list of
options. The menu map is shown on the following page.
When the handset is switched on and in standby, press
the option button under MENU to open the main menu.
Press the or button to scroll to the menu option
you want. Then press
OK to select further options or
confirm the setting displayed.
For example to change the handset ringer volume:
1. Press MENU then scroll to
Personalise
and press OK.
2. Press
OK to select
Handset
, scroll to
Ring Volume
then press OK.
3. The current setting is displayed. Press to increase or
to decrease the volume, the ringtone is played at each
level you select. Press
OK to confirm.
Exit or go back one level in the handset menu
To the previous level in the menu, press BACK.
To cancel and return to standby at any time, press .
If no button is pressed for 60 seconds, the handset
returns to standby automatically.
